Completed in 1363, this mosque is also considered one of the largest, not only in Cairo but in the entire Islamic world. It is a massive structure measuring some 150 meters long and 36 meters high. It's tallest minaret is 68 meters tall.Sultan Hassan Mosque (l) and Mosque of ar-Rifai (r), viewed from the Citadel. Cairo, Egypt
